資源描述:
《網(wǎng)絡(luò)體系結(jié)構(gòu)和基本概念》由會(huì)員上傳分享,免費(fèi)在線閱讀,更多相關(guān)內(nèi)容在教育資源-天天文庫(kù)。
1、第4章網(wǎng)絡(luò)體系結(jié)構(gòu)和基本概念4.1簡(jiǎn)介建立網(wǎng)絡(luò)體系結(jié)構(gòu)的目的為了減少計(jì)算機(jī)網(wǎng)絡(luò)的復(fù)雜程度,按照結(jié)構(gòu)化設(shè)計(jì)方法,計(jì)算機(jī)網(wǎng)絡(luò)將其功能劃分為若干個(gè)層次,較高層次建立在較低層次的基礎(chǔ)上,并為其更高層次提供必要的服務(wù)功能。網(wǎng)絡(luò)中的每一層都起到隔離作用,使得低層功能具體實(shí)現(xiàn)方法的變更不會(huì)影響到高一層所執(zhí)行的功能。網(wǎng)絡(luò)體系結(jié)構(gòu)的定義完成計(jì)算機(jī)間的通信合作,把每個(gè)計(jì)算機(jī)互聯(lián)的功能劃分成有明確定義的層次,并規(guī)定同層次進(jìn)程通信的協(xié)議及相鄰層之間的接口服務(wù);4.2計(jì)算機(jī)網(wǎng)絡(luò)協(xié)議協(xié)議(Protocol)協(xié)議就是為實(shí)現(xiàn)網(wǎng)絡(luò)中的數(shù)據(jù)交換建立的規(guī)則標(biāo)準(zhǔn)或約定。協(xié)議的中心任務(wù)在計(jì)算機(jī)
2、網(wǎng)絡(luò)的一整套規(guī)則中,任何一種協(xié)議都需要解決3方面的問(wèn)題。①協(xié)議的語(yǔ)法(如何講)問(wèn)題。②協(xié)議的語(yǔ)義(講什么)問(wèn)題。③協(xié)議的定時(shí)(講話次序)問(wèn)題。協(xié)議的功能作為計(jì)算機(jī)數(shù)據(jù)交換語(yǔ)言的協(xié)議必須具備以下一些功能。(1)分割與重組協(xié)議的“分割”功能,可以將較大的數(shù)據(jù)單元分割成較小的數(shù)據(jù)單元,其反過(guò)程為“重組”,如下圖所示。(2)???尋址協(xié)議的“尋址”功能使得設(shè)備彼此識(shí)別,同時(shí)可以進(jìn)行路徑選擇,如下圖所示。(3)封裝與拆封協(xié)議的“封裝”功能是指在數(shù)據(jù)單元(數(shù)據(jù)包)的始端或者末端增加控制信息,其相反的過(guò)程是“拆封”(拆裝),如下圖所示。(4)???排序協(xié)議的排序功能
3、是指報(bào)文發(fā)送與接收順序的控制,如下圖所示。(5)???信息流控制協(xié)議的流量控制功能是指在信息流過(guò)大時(shí),所采取的一系列措施。(6)???差錯(cuò)控制差錯(cuò)控制功能使得數(shù)據(jù)按誤碼率要求的指標(biāo),在通信線路中正確地傳輸。(7)???同步協(xié)議的同步功能可以保證收發(fā)雙方在數(shù)據(jù)傳輸時(shí)的一致性(8)干路傳輸協(xié)議的干路傳輸功能可以使多個(gè)用戶信息共用干路。(9)連接控制協(xié)議的連接控制功能可以控制通信實(shí)體之間建立和終止鏈路的過(guò)程。協(xié)議的種類(1)標(biāo)準(zhǔn)或非標(biāo)準(zhǔn)協(xié)議標(biāo)準(zhǔn)協(xié)議涉及各類的通信環(huán)境;而非標(biāo)準(zhǔn)協(xié)議只涉及專用環(huán)境。(2)直接或間接協(xié)議當(dāng)設(shè)備直接進(jìn)行通信時(shí),需要一種直接通信協(xié)議;
4、而設(shè)備之間,間接通信時(shí),則需要一種間接通信協(xié)議。4.3計(jì)算機(jī)網(wǎng)絡(luò)體系結(jié)構(gòu)郵政系統(tǒng)的工作流程通信者活動(dòng)界面通信者活動(dòng)界面郵局服務(wù)業(yè)務(wù)郵局服務(wù)業(yè)務(wù)郵局轉(zhuǎn)運(yùn)業(yè)務(wù)郵局轉(zhuǎn)運(yùn)業(yè)務(wù)運(yùn)輸部門(mén)的(郵件)運(yùn)輸業(yè)務(wù)書(shū)寫(xiě)信件粘貼郵票投遞進(jìn)信箱收集信件加蓋郵戳郵件分檢郵件打包轉(zhuǎn)送運(yùn)輸部門(mén)選擇運(yùn)輸路徑(路由)轉(zhuǎn)送郵局接收郵件接收郵件郵件拆包郵件投遞郵件分檢信箱取信閱讀郵件發(fā)信者收信者計(jì)算機(jī)網(wǎng)絡(luò)體系結(jié)構(gòu)的特點(diǎn)①各層之間相互獨(dú)立。這樣,某一高層只需知道如何通過(guò)接口(界面)向下一層提出服務(wù)請(qǐng)求,并使用下層提供的服務(wù),并不需要了解下層執(zhí)行時(shí)的細(xì)節(jié)。②結(jié)構(gòu)上獨(dú)立分割。由于各層獨(dú)立劃分,因此
5、,每層都可以選擇最合適的實(shí)現(xiàn)技術(shù)。③靈活性好。如果某一層發(fā)生變化,只要接口的條件不變、則以上各層和以下各層的工作均不受影響,這樣,有利于技術(shù)進(jìn)步和模型的修改。④易于實(shí)現(xiàn)和維護(hù)。整個(gè)系統(tǒng)被分割為多個(gè)部分,系統(tǒng)變得容易實(shí)現(xiàn)、管理和維護(hù)。⑤有益于標(biāo)準(zhǔn)化的實(shí)現(xiàn)。由于每一層都有明確的定義,十分利于標(biāo)準(zhǔn)化的實(shí)施。網(wǎng)絡(luò)體系結(jié)構(gòu)化分的基本原則是:把應(yīng)用程序和網(wǎng)絡(luò)通信管理程序分開(kāi);同時(shí)又按照信息在網(wǎng)絡(luò)中傳輸?shù)倪^(guò)程,將通信管理程序分為若干個(gè)模塊;把原來(lái)專用的通信接口轉(zhuǎn)變?yōu)楣玫?、?biāo)準(zhǔn)化的通信接口。4.4ISO/OSI網(wǎng)絡(luò)體系結(jié)構(gòu)國(guó)際標(biāo)準(zhǔn)化組織(InternationalS
6、tandardsOrganization,ISO)于1981年頒布了開(kāi)放系統(tǒng)互連OSI參考模型(OpenSystemInterconnectionReferenceModel,OSI/RM)的格式,通常簡(jiǎn)稱為“七層模型”,參見(jiàn)下圖OSI網(wǎng)絡(luò)體系結(jié)構(gòu)的示意圖OSI參考模型各層的功能OSI參考模型每一層的功能、傳輸?shù)臄?shù)據(jù)單元,以及特點(diǎn)如下:1.物理層(PhysicalLayer)物理層是OSI模型的第1層,該層傳輸以“位”為單位的數(shù)據(jù)流,其主要功能用一句話表示就是“確定如何使用物理傳輸介質(zhì),實(shí)現(xiàn)兩個(gè)節(jié)點(diǎn)間的物理連接,透明地傳送比特位流?!薄!f(shuō)明:第一,物
7、理層直接與物理信道相連接,因此物理層是7層中惟一的“實(shí)連接層”;而其他各層由于都間接地使用到物理層的功能,因此為“虛連接層”。第二,“透明”是一個(gè)很重要的術(shù)語(yǔ)。它表示的是某一個(gè)實(shí)際存在的事物看起來(lái)卻好像不存在一樣。OSI參考模型各層的功能(續(xù))2.數(shù)據(jù)鏈路層(DataLinkLayer)數(shù)據(jù)鏈路層是OSI模型的第2層,該層傳輸以“幀”為單位的數(shù)據(jù)單元,其主要功能用一句話表示就是“在物理層服務(wù)的基礎(chǔ)上,通過(guò)各種控制協(xié)議,將有差錯(cuò)的實(shí)際物理信道變?yōu)闊o(wú)差錯(cuò)的、能可靠傳輸數(shù)據(jù)的數(shù)據(jù)鏈路”。3.網(wǎng)絡(luò)層(NetworkLayer)網(wǎng)絡(luò)層是OSI模型的第3層,該層傳
8、輸以“分組”為單位的數(shù)據(jù)單元,其主要任務(wù)用一句話表示就是“為數(shù)據(jù)通過(guò)網(wǎng)絡(luò)建立邏輯鏈接,即該層通